Azzerbaijan is the most east country of Europe. Due to location it was a cross-walk of the civilization. Zoarastirans, Jewish, Christians, Muslims - you can find heritage of each cutural. Let me show some of the intereting places and we can start with abandoned island -just in a Baku bay.
Caravansaray in Middle Ages analogue of the modern motels. Traders with camels and servants were heading from China to Europe by a Silk route. One of the routes were crossing territory of the modern Azerbaijan and it has a lot of interesting spots.
Not far from Baku, in the Gobustan desert, which has also excited my memory and consciousness for many years.There are a lot of all sorts of historical artifacts in this desert, but now let’s talk about, perhaps, the most preserved of them.
I first saw this building in 1985, back in the days of the existence of the pioneers (soviet analogue of the scout movement) and, accordingly, the pioneer campaigns. Our young teacher was an active woman, eager to teach children, and that day, according to the plan, whole class hat a hiking trip to the highest mud volcano in the world – Turugay
This was a bit of a strange idea, since there are rams, shepherds and dogs wandering around. For a shepherd’s dogs it was no differnt whom to eat – either a true pioneer or a bully – they both taste the same.
We had a big class? more than 40 persons? so we split into groups and went to the ascent. The sun is hot, the blacksmiths are jumping out from under the feet, the air is saturated with a purely Baku smell – the smell of the sea, sun, sand and burnt grass.
It was suggested to take halts often, and at the first halt, someone from our group suddenly saw this – a strange structure in the middle of the desert.
